Chugging - 2006 Jeep TJ
 
has anyone had this problem, or know what to do about it? As soon as the jeep hits 2500 - 2600 RPm the Jeep starts chugging. I've changed the throttle sensor. that didn't work. Anyone have any suggestions??

Has it been raining allot? May sound funny but my eng light came on one day and I have a very good friend with a meter that chk'd it and came up with a code (change sensor) $100 or so.(for a useless pc of ...) He told me to ck the connections to all the sensors (theres 3 or 4 on the exhaust system) also that it could be just too much water or a piece of dirt stuck under the sensor, first try to ck connections, then put some injector cleaner in at 2 different tank fills, try disconnecting the battery for 30 mins (resets computor), this may clear the code and it may come back again. Try the cheap way b/4 wasting money on these useless sensors. Oh yes if it had stayed on a small pc of electrical tape works wonders. :)
